Reviewer notes for the Thistlecart migration: we are replacing the homegrown job queue with Kilnworks. Please check that every enqueue call uses the new idempotency wrapper and that retries are capped. Legacy handlers are quarantined under a compatibility shim. To open the sealed migration checklist, enter the recovery passphrase that follows below.

strongbox words: ralys-quenion-quenael-norok-zorvan

Management Meeting Minutes — Divestment of Corvale Unit

Attendees: senior leadership. Decision: proceed with sale of the Corvale services unit to Hartwen Group, subject to diligence. Sales leads to pause new multi-year Corvale contracts immediately. Existing customers transition under current terms. Communications embargoed until signing. Staff questions route to the transition office. Timeline: close expected next quarter. Context for the decision is set out in the note below.

management briefing: Jorixax Holdings is in early talks to buy Casixax Holdings for about $420.3 million. The Fenmir launch date is October 27, and nothing goes to the press before then. Legal wants the Keloxek Foods term sheet redrafted before April 16.

TURN-208: Gatevale turnstile counters at the Merrow Field pilot double-count when a rotation reverses mid-cycle. Attendance totals drift roughly 2% high per event. The debounce window fix is implemented, reviewed by Ilsa, and soak-tested across two simulated match days without drift. Ready for your cut; the candidate build is identified below.

trace token, tagag-tafog: htk6_5ed18c